Caulk Type Essentials
Selecting the right caulk matters for both performance and longevity; the choice hinges on substrate, environment, and movement. You evaluate substrate compatibility first: nonporous surfaces demand silicone or polyurethane for adhesion, while porous materials tolerate acrylic or siliconized acrylics with better tooling. Environment governs durability: bathrooms require mold resistance and temperature/humidity tolerance; exteriors need UV stability and weatherproofing. Movement rating matters; choose higher elongation for joints that flex. For windows, consider glazing compound types that bond to glass and frames without cracking. Caulk color and caulk texture influence appearance and finish; choose color to harmonize with trims or contrast for visibility. Prioritize service life, cure profile, and cleanability to minimize maintenance and callbacks.

Surface Prep for a Flawless Seal
Surface prep for a flawless seal begins with a clean, dry substrate. You inspect the joint, remove old caulk, and sand any glossy surfaces to promote adhesion. Use a scraper, utility knife, and controlled pressure to avoid gouging the substrate. Wipe with a solvent compatible with the materials you’re sealing, then let it dry completely before applying primer if required. Check for moisture infiltration, as dampness undermines cure and longevity. Ensure the profile is consistent: a firm edge for proper sealant seating, with minimal gaps or bevels that trap air. During prep, confirm material compatibility between caulk, paint, and underlying substrates to prevent chemical reactions. Document substrate porosity and contamination levels, because surface preparation directly influences bond strength, cure, and long-term performance.

How to Apply a Clean Caulk Bead

Once you have a properly loaded cartridge, apply steady pressure on the trigger and guide the nozzle along the joint, keeping a consistent distance from the surface to guarantee a uniform bead. Maintain a steady speed to avoid gaps, sags, or excessive squeeze-out. Use a controlled, continuous pass and then pause briefly to let the bead set before tooling. For color matching, choose a sealant that aligns with the substrate and finished look, ensuring a seamless appearance. Apply the bead slightly wider than the joint to allow for cleanup and adhesion variation. After application, inspect the bead for gaps and uniform thickness, correcting immediately. Practice tool maintenance by cleaning the nozzle and gun tip promptly, storing in a clean, dry environment to preserve performance and material properties.

Troubleshooting Leaks, Cracks, and Gaps
Most leaks, cracks, and gaps in caulking are indicators of improper adhesion, material incompatibility, or joint movement; diagnose the source quickly to choose the correct remedy. You’ll test adhesion, inspect substrate compatibility, and assess movement to pinpoint failure modes. If adhesion is poor, remove failed sections and reapply with a compatible sealant. If joints flex, use a high-elasticity product rated for movement. If substrate is damp, address moisture before resealing. Humidity control and mold prevention must be integrated into the plan to guarantee lasting performance.
- Test substrate compatibility and surface preparation
- Select a sealant with appropriate elasticity and chemical resistance
- Verify moisture levels and dry times before final cure

Is Latex Caulk Enough for Bathrooms?
No, latex caulk isn’t enough for bathrooms. You’ll want a silicone or latex-silicone hybrid for better latex durability and bathroom moisture resistance, ensuring ongoing seal integrity in wet environments. Use proper prep and curing for reliable performance.
Do Different Surfaces Require Different Sealants?
Yes, surface compatibility matters; different surfaces require different sealant types. You’ll match substrates, flex, and moisture. Choose silicone for showers, acrylic for trims, and polyurethane for exterior joints to guarantee durable, leak-free seals.
